Rameshwaram weather: Best time to visit Rameshwaram

The weather in Rameshwaram remains warm and humid for most of the year due to its coastal location in Tamil Nadu. However, the winter season from October to February is considered the most comfortable time for sightseeing, temple visits, and beach exploration. Travellers can enjoy pleasant temperatures and smoother travel conditions during this period.

  • Summer (March to June): Summers are usually hot and humid, with high temperatures during the daytime. Outdoor activities and local sightseeing may become tiring during peak afternoon hours.
  • Monsoon (July to September): Rameshwaram receives moderate rainfall during the monsoon season. The surroundings appear fresh and scenic, but occasional rain showers may affect travel plans and outdoor visits.
  • Winter (October to February): Winter is the ideal season to explore Rameshwaram. The cooler weather makes it easier to visit temples, beaches, and nearby attractions comfortably.

Rameshwaram in Summer

Summer in Rameshwaram is hot and humid, with temperatures ranging from 27°C to 40°C. Exploring the town under the harsh sun can be difficult.

Weather Table

MonthTemperature (°C)Rainfall (mm)
March27 - 35Low
April29 - 37Low
May30 - 40Low
June28 - 38Moderate


If you visit in summer, explore in the early morning or evening and wear light cotton clothes.

Rameshwaram in Winter

Winter is the best season to visit Rameshwaram. With temperatures between 20°C and 30°C, it is perfect for temple visits, sightseeing, and outdoor activities.

Weather Table

MonthTemperature (°C)Rainfall (mm)
October25 - 31Moderate
November23 - 30Moderate
December20 - 28Low
January20 - 27Low
February22 - 30Low


Cool and dry weather makes winter the peak season for tourists.

Rameshwaram in Monsoon

Monsoon brings moderate to heavy rains, making the weather cooler but affecting sightseeing plans. However, the rains enhance the town’s scenic beauty.

Weather Table

MonthTemperature (°C)Rainfall (mm)
July25 - 32High
August25 - 31High
September24 - 30Moderate


If you enjoy peaceful surroundings and lush landscapes, monsoon is a good time to visit. But rain may disrupt outdoor activities.

How many days are required to visit Rameshwaram?

A 2 to 3-day trip is generally enough to explore Rameshwaram's major attractions, including Ramanathaswamy Temple, Dhanushkodi, Agni Theertham, and Pamban Bridge. When is Rameshwaram Temple less crowded?
Rameshwaram Temple is less crowded on weekdays, early mornings, and non-festive months like June, July, and September. Avoid visiting during festivals and weekends, as it gets heavily crowded.

Which month is best for Rameshwaram?
The best month to visit Rameshwaram is December or January, as the weather is cool and pleasant. These months are ideal for temple visits, sightseeing, and exploring nearby attractions.

When not to visit Rameshwaram?
Avoid visiting Rameshwaram in May and June, as the summer heat is intense. Monsoon months like July and August can also be inconvenient due to heavy rainfall and humidity.

Which is the coldest month in Rameshwaram?
December is the coldest month, with temperatures ranging between 20°C and 28°C. It is the best time for comfortable sightseeing and temple visits without extreme heat or humidity.
